To understand the impact of Tamilrockers on Malayalam cinema, one must first understand the platform's origins. Ironically, despite its name, Tamilrockers was not exclusively created for Tamil cinema. It began as a small, underground network but quickly expanded its tentacles to include Telugu, Hindi, Kannada, and Malayalam films. For Malayalam cinema, the timing of Tamilrockers’ rise was detrimental. Just as the industry was moving away from traditional theatrical viewing and beginning to rely on satellite rights and, later, digital streaming platforms to reach wider audiences, piracy struck a severe blow to these emerging revenue streams.
